'Irrational': Tech Mahindra CEO Flags Rivals' Unrealistic Productivity Deals, Flat Pricing Amid Rising Chip Costs

Tech Mahindra's CEO has criticized competitors for offering unrealistic productivity guarantees and flat pricing despite rising chip costs. He argues that such deals are unsustainable and could lead to financial strain for vendors.
This development matters to investors as it highlights potential pricing pressures in the IT services sector. If competitors cannot maintain these aggressive terms, it could impact revenue growth and margins for leading players like Tech Mahindra.
Investors should watch for how the company responds to this competitive landscape. A shift toward more sustainable pricing models or a focus on value-added services could signal a positive strategy for long-term stability.
